Zebra Dove

Geopelia striata

Description:

White bellied bird with brown wings that have tan accents. When the bird took to the air it almost looked like it had blue on the underside of its wings that matches its face. In size, it seemed probably 16-18 cm long from head to tail.

Habitat:

This bird was picking its way through the grass around a canal amidst farmed fields in northern Thailand.
